SunRisers Leeds Stay Alive After Tight Hundred Win Over London Spirit
What happened: SunRisers Leeds beat London Spirit by five wickets at Headingley, according to Sky News, in a result that keeps their faint hopes of progressing from The Hundred group stage alive. The confirmed margin matters: this was not a statement blowout, but a hard-fought chase that went deep enough to be described as tight.

Annabel Sutherland was the central figure for SunRisers with the bat. The source summary does not provide her score, the target, or the over-by-over shape of the chase, so the clean read is limited but useful: SunRisers found enough batting control under pressure to get over the line, and Sutherland was the standout contributor in that part of the match.
